Word Meaning ワン切り

わんぎり wangiri

ワン切り is read as わんぎり (wangiri) and means one-ring hang-up call (to receive a call back, oft. for scams).

Meaning

English

  1. one-ring hang-up call (to receive a call back, oft. for scams)
  2. missed call for exchanging phone numbers
  3. wangiri
